结论:在阿里云服务器上搭建宝塔面板是一种快速部署网站环境的有效方式,适合新手和中小型项目使用。整个过程主要包括购买ECS实例、配置安全组、安装宝塔面板以及配置网站环境等步骤。
一、准备工作
在开始之前,你需要准备以下内容:
- 阿里云账号:注册并登录阿里云官网。
- ECS服务器实例:选择合适的地域、操作系统(推荐CentOS 7.x或更高版本)、带宽和磁盘空间。
- 远程连接工具:如Xshell、PuTTY或阿里云自带的远程连接工具。
二、配置ECS服务器
-
创建ECS实例
- 选择“按量付费”或“包年包月”,根据需求选择合适配置。
- 操作系统建议选择 CentOS 7.x 或以上版本,兼容性更好。
- 设置登录密码或密钥对,确保后续可以远程登录。
-
配置安全组规则
- 进入ECS控制台的安全组设置。
- 添加放行端口:
- HTTP:80
- HTTPS:443
- SSH:22
- 宝塔默认端口:8888(可自定义)
- 确保这些端口允许公网访问。
三、安装宝塔面板
-
通过SSH连接服务器
- 使用命令行工具登录到你的ECS服务器。
-
执行安装脚本
- 根据不同系统选择对应的安装命令:
y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h- 执行后等待几分钟,系统会自动下载并安装宝塔面板。
-
获取登录地址和初始账号密码
- 安装完成后,终端会输出宝塔面板的登录地址、用户名和密码。
- 请务必截图保存相关信息,并修改默认密码以确保安全。
四、配置宝塔面板与网站环境
-
登录宝塔面板
- 浏览器输入给出的地址(通常是
http://服务器IP:8888)。 - 输入用户名和密码进入面板。
- 浏览器输入给出的地址(通常是
-
安装LNMP环境
- 推荐选择 Nginx + MySQL + PHP 的组合。
- 宝塔提供一键安装功能,选择需要的版本即可。
-
添加站点
- 在“网站”菜单中点击“添加站点”。
- 填写域名(如果没有域名可用IP访问),选择网站根目录。
- 可选是否创建数据库和FTP账户。
-
上传网站文件
- 可以通过宝塔的文件管理器上传网页文件,也可以通过FTP或Git进行部署。
五、注意事项
- 备份重要数据:定期备份网站文件和数据库,防止意外丢失。
- 监控资源使用情况:使用宝塔的监控插件或阿里云监控服务,防止服务器负载过高。
- 保持面板更新:宝塔官方经常发布新版本修复漏洞,建议定期检查更新。
- 开启防火墙功能:宝塔自带的防火墙可以有效防御常见攻击。
总结
在阿里云服务器上搭建宝塔面板是一个高效且易于操作的方式,特别适合快速部署Web项目。
通过上述步骤,你可以轻松完成从服务器配置到网站上线的全过程。无论是个人博客还是企业官网,宝塔都能提供稳定可靠的运行环境。
如果你是初学者,建议结合官方文档和社区教程进一步深入学习,提高运维效率。
云知道CLOUD